Quick notes on the revamped password reset flow for Nimblecart: resets now go through the Foxglove token service instead of the old mailer hack. Tokens expire in 15 minutes, and reuse attempts get logged to the audit stream. If you're testing locally, point your client at the Foxglove staging endpoint and authenticate with the internal service key shown below.

service key, fawip-bajef: kto11_Qt5wZK9vdNC

Audit item 14: Websocket compression on Fernwick Relay

Check whether permessage-deflate is still enabled on the chat relay. It saves bandwidth but chews CPU during spikes, and we've been burned twice. If CPU sits above 70% during peak, flip it off and note it in the log. Questions on the tradeoff call go to the subsystem owner listed below.

account owner for bawip-tahag: Raleth Quenok

Postmortem timeline — Garagewise occupancy feed (week of the Larkmont outage). At 09:14 the feed from the Hollis Street garage began reporting stale counts; the poller in Stallgrid kept accepting cached frames because the freshness check compared against the wrong clock. By 09:41 downstream dashboards showed 140% occupancy, and Priya's team paused the publisher. We restored accurate counts at 10:06 after redeploying with the corrected freshness guard. For the sync, note that the fix shipped in the hotfix build referenced below.

trace token, bawef-hagug: htk14_86959b54a07f99

**Ticket: Undo stack corrupted by third-party node plugins**

Sketchloom's undo/redo breaks when a plugin mutates node geometry outside a transaction. Redo then replays stale coordinates. Plugin authors: wrap all mutations in `beginEdit`/`commitEdit`, no direct model writes. We now reject untransacted writes in dev mode and log a warning in prod. Fix ships in the next editor release; plugins compiled against older SDKs keep working but lose undo granularity. Reference the build token below when filing compatibility reports.

session token of fahof-hagug = htk4_d6de